Output 59e17db411658955a14849133079dfaf742e5d081052211bd39c18d4e1d121b2:1

value
392854000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bbe80635d2bc9726861607f4bc5845276e2aa8c OP_EQUALVERIFY OP_CHECKSIG
address
1Dju8wdHJhzQmjYYr7JJvoLR6vQPaaj4Q6
transaction
59e17db411658955a14849133079dfaf742e5d081052211bd39c18d4e1d121b2
confirmations
631965
spent
true